Map pours 3 2/3 cup of orange juice into measuring cup from a large container then he poured 1 1/4 cups back into the container how much orange juice remains in the measuring cup

Answers

Answer:

2 5/12 cups

Step-by-step explanation:

Map pours 3 2/3 cup of orange juice into measuring cup from a large container then he poured 1 1/4 cups back into the container

The amount of juice remaining in the measuring cup is calculated as:

3 2/3 - 1 1/4

= 3 - 1 + ( 2/3 - 1/4)

LCD = Lowest Common Denominator is 12

= 2 + (4 × 2 - 3 × 1/12)

= 2 + (8 - 3/12)

= 2 + 5/12

= 2 5/12 cups

Hence, the amount of juice remaining in the measuring cup = 2 5/12 cups of juice

Which of the following sets of numbers could be the lengths of the sides of a triangle?a. 2 in., 4 in., 6 in.
b. 2 in., 4 in., 5 in.
c. 2 in., 6 in., 12 in.
d. 2 in., 8 in., 14 in.

Answers

ok
longest side measure must be less than the sum of the other 2 sides
basically
longestside<otherside1+otherside2

a.
longest is 6
6<4+2
6<6
false, cannot

b.
 longest is 5
5<4+2
5<6
true, can be a triangle

c. longest is 12
12<6+2
12<8
false, cannot

d. longest is 14
14<8+2
14<10
false, cannot


B is only possible
